Green Rock Energy Limited is engaged in exploration and development of oil and gas and geothermal resources. The Alkimos Project consists of two Geothermal Exploration Permits (GEP 2 and GEP 39) covering a total of 340 square kilometer within the Perth Metropolitan area with potential to recover geothermal energy from hot sedimentary aquifers to provide thermal power for district heating and cooling systems and desalination of water. The North Perth Basin Project consists of seven GEPs (GEP 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28 and GEP 41) covering 2,100 square kilometer with potential to recover geothermal energy from hot sedimentary aquifers and crystalline basement to provide thermal power for conversion to electrical energy. The Company held four Geothermal Exploration Licences (GEL) at the Olympic Dam mining operation in South Australia, approximately 550 kilometer north northwest of Adelaide.
